iStation is a website and/or app provided by LISD used for monthly phonemic awareness assessing and daily practice of phonics and reading skills. Please avoid using this the first week of every month.
iStation log in is accessed through the Leander Launchpad and Classlink.
(If using iPad/tablet - (MUST FIRST HAVE iSTATION DOWNLOADED FROM APP STORE))
1. Sign in on Launchpad or use QR code on the Classlink app to get on to the Launchpad
2. Find the iStation app icon and click on it
3. iStation should automatically prompt open the app and log your student in
4. Click "Reading" to begin / DO NOT USE THE ISIP BUTTON!!
When done, students will click red "stop" button for it to save their progress.
Dreambox is a website and/or app provided by LISD for daily practice of mathematic skills taught in Kindergarten.
Dreambox log in is accessed through the Leander Launchpad and Classlink.
(If using iPad/tablet - (MUST FIRST HAVE DREAMBOX DOWNLOADED FROM APP STORE))
1. Sign in or use QR code on Classlink to get on to the Launchpad
2. Find the Dreambox app and click on it
3. Dreambox should automatically prompt open the website/app and log your student in
4. Their name should appear in the left hand corner and they should hear a voice telling them "Welcome to the Dreambox Neighborhood!"
